Stratis 3.0 帶來了一些重要的改進和變化

STRATIS

最近 推出 分支的新版本意味著從 Stratis 3.0,這是一個由紅哈開發的工具t 和 Fedora 社區統一和簡化一組一個或多個本地驅動器的配置和管理。

STRATIS 擅長提供動態存儲分配等能力、快照、一致性和緩存層。 自 Fedora 28 和 RHEL 8.2 起,Stratis 支持已集成到 Fedora 和 RHEL 發行版中。

該系統在其功能上很大程度上複製了用於管理 ZFS 和 Btrfs 分區的高級工具,但是 作為中間層實現 (stratisd 守護進程)運行在 Linux 內核設備映射器子系統(dm-thin、dm-cache、dm-thinpool、dm-raid 和 dm-integration 模塊)和 XFS 文件系統之上。

與 ZFS 和 Btrfs 不同,Stratis 組件僅在用戶空間中運行 並且它們不需要加載特定的內核模塊。 該項目最初被認為不需要存儲專家的資格進行管理。

D-Bus API 和 cli 實用程序用於管理。 斯特拉蒂斯 已使用基於 LUKS 的塊設備進行測試 (加密分區)、mdraid、dm-multipath、iSCSI、LVM 邏輯卷以及各種硬盤、SSD 和 NVMe 驅動器。 通過池中的一個磁盤,Stratis 允許您使用啟用快照的邏輯分區來恢復更改。

將多個驅動器添加到組中時,您可以在邏輯上組合連續區域中的驅動器。 目前尚不支持 RAID、數據壓縮、重複數據刪除和容錯等功能,但計劃在未來使用。

Stratis 3.0的主要新功能

在這個新版本的 Stratis 3.0 中,強調了版本號的重大變化是由於 D-Bus 控制接口的變化,尤其是在接口支持結束時 FetchProperties 支持使用基於 D-Bus 的屬性和方法。

關於這個新版本中已經包含的變化,我們可以發現 使用 libblkid 添加 udev 規則檢查 在進行更改之前。

除此之外,還突出顯示了對 DeviceMapper 事件的處理進行了重新設計,還對錯誤處理程序的內部表示進行了更改。

另一方面,公告中提到開發商 他們專注於在代碼中重新設計的這個新分支 能夠恢復更改,這也允許在創建文件系統時指定邏輯大小。

在這個 Stratis 3.0 新版本的公告中也提到,在框架中 羊角,用於自動加密和解密磁盤分區上的數據,使用 SHA-256 哈希而不是 SHA-1,它 為用戶提供了更改密碼短語的能力,並且還可以控制重新生成到 Clevis 的鏈接。

終於 如果您想了解更多 關於這個新版本,您可以檢查更改列表 在下面的鏈接中。

如何安裝Stratis?

對於那些有興趣嘗試這個工具的人,他們應該知道 Stratis 可用於 RHEL、CentOS、Fedora 和衍生產品。 它的安裝非常簡單,因為該軟件包位於RHEL存儲庫及其派生版本中。

為了安裝Stratis 只需在終端中運行以下命令:

sudo dnf install stratis-cli stratisd -y

或者您也可以嘗試以下其他方法:

sudo yum install stratis-cli stratisd -y

一旦安裝在系統上, 必須啟用Stratis服務,他們通過執行以下命令來做到這一點:

sudo systemctl start stratisd.service
sudo systemctl enable stratisd.service
sudo systemctl status stratisd.service

有關配置和使用的更多信息,您可以訪問以下鏈接。 https://stratis-storage.github.io/howto/


發表您的評論

您的電子郵件地址將不會被發表。 必填字段標有 *

*

*

  1. 負責數據:MiguelÁngelGatón
  2. 數據用途:控制垃圾郵件,註釋管理。
  3. 合法性:您的同意
  4. 數據通訊:除非有法律義務,否則不會將數據傳達給第三方。
  5. 數據存儲:Occentus Networks(EU)託管的數據庫
  6. 權利:您可以隨時限制,恢復和刪除您的信息。